# This shell script installs all OS package dependencies for Apache
# CouchDB 2.x for yum-based systems.
#
# While these scripts are primarily written to support building CI
# Docker images, they can be used on any workstation to install a
# suitable build environment.
# stop on error
set -e
fake-rpm() {
tmpdir=/tmp/$1rpm
mkdir -p $tmpdir/rpmbuild/{SOURCES,BUILD,RPMS}/noarch
cat > $tmpdir/rpmbuild/SOURCES/README <<EOF
Fake package to appease later package builders.
EOF
cat > $tmpdir/fake$1.spec <<EOF
Name: fake-$1
Version: $2
Release: 1%{?dist}
Summary: Fake package for $1
Group: Fake
License: BSD
BuildRoot: %(mktemp -ud %{_tmppath}/%{name}-%{version}-%{release}-XXXXXX)
Source: README
Provides: $1
BuildArch: noarch
%description
%{summary}
%prep
%setup -c -T
%build
cp %{SOURCE0} .
%install
%files
%defattr(-,root,root,-)
%doc README
%changelog
EOF
rpmbuild --verbose -bb --define "_topdir $tmpdir/rpmbuild" $tmpdir/fake$1.spec
yum --nogpgcheck localinstall -y $tmpdir/rpmbuild/RPMS/*/*.rpm
rm -rf $tmpdir
}
